Moreira da Silva vows to be ‘totally focused’ on new UN position in coming years

Former PSD leader candidate Jorge Moreira da Silva assured this Thursday that he will be “totally focused” on the United Nations post to which he has been appointed in the coming years.

“It is with pleasure and a sense of responsibility that I welcome the decision announced today by the Secretary General of the United Nations to appoint me, following an international public competition, as Executive Director of UNOPS (United Nations Infrastructure and Project Management Agency) and Deputy Secretary General of the United Nations (Deputy Secretary General),” – the statement of the former vice-president of the SDP says.

According to Moreira da Silva, it was a “competitive process” in which he participated individually.

“In the coming years, I will be fully focused on this mission of leading the local construction and management of the necessary infrastructure for sustainable development, security and peace, as well as combating inequality and climate change,” he assured.

Last April, the former SDP leader announced his resignation as director of development cooperation at the OECD, a position he had held since 2016 to run for the leadership of the SDP, a position he ran and lost to Luis Montenegro at the end of May .

Jorge Moreira da Silva is a visiting professor at the Faculty of Engineering at the University of Porto (FEUP), a visiting professor at the Institute of Political Studies in Paris (Sciences Po), and senior adviser to the North American non-governmental organization Fourth Sector Group. He is also President of the Platform for Sustainable Growth (PCS) think tank, which he founded in 2011.

The announcement of the name of Jorge Moreira da Silva, who will replace Dane Jens Wandel, was announced by UN Secretary General António Guterres.

Prior to joining the OECD, Moreira da Silva, who holds a degree in Electrical Engineering (Energy Field), was Minister of the Environment, Spatial Planning and Energy from 2013 to 2015, and from 2003 to 2005 he was Secretary of State for Science and Higher Education and Public Secretary for Environment and Spatial Planning, and Member of Parliament and European MP.

UNOPS is the operational entity of the United Nations whose mission is to help diverse partners implement humanitarian, development and peacebuilding projects in the world’s most challenging environments through sustainable practices.
